WebIn flyback as well as boost circuits, the diode is the output element. All current to the output filter capacitor and load must flow through the diode, so the steady-state DC load current must equal the average diode current. WebThe Flyback transformer is similar to a buck-boost topology with an added transformer. The transformer provides isolation, step-up/step-down control using its winding turns ratio, and multi-output capabilities.
